We just returned from a week in Halifax and found a new resturant that I think you would love. BISH It is located on the far end of the harbor boardwalk about 2-3 blocks before you get to the Westin Hotel. Since it is right on the water, if the weather is cooperative, you can eat outside. It is a first class restaurant. I had the stir fried lobster with a crispy spinich that was divine

Hello from Halifax, Nova Scotia. Try du Marizios in the Brewery Market. Wonderful Italian food. Great food and atmosphere at Opa's (Greek). You'll feel as if you are in a real greek taverna. I am not sure if they still have it, but the Westin had a seafood buffet on Saturday evenings - lots to eat and good food. There is a new turkish restaurant off Spring Garden Road that I have heard great reviews. Ryan Duffy's for steak. ALl of these restuarants are in downtown Halifax. In Dartmouth La Perla is a great Italian restaurant! McElvies in the Ferry Terminal building has great views and good food. <BR> <BR>Hope this helps!
